Fault: "Vessel Overtemp." What should I do?

The vessel temperature has exceeded the maximum limit.

Possible Causes:

(1) The solution level is low in the vessel, but the level sensor is indicating full. The level sensor has two main components that work together. These components are a Level Sensor Module and the Glass Sensor Tip. Refer to DELTA Service Procedure Analog Level Sensor Cleaning and Testing (DES007). 

(2) If the level sensor is not working, it may need replacing. Refer to DELTA Service Procedure Level Sensor Analog Cable and Glass Tip Replacement (DES009) to replace the Analog Level Sensor Glass Tip and Fiber Optic Cable (Part #: A32).

(3) The vessel is overfilled with the solution. The Level Sensor is not detecting the solution. Refer to DELTA Service Procedure Analog Level Sensor Cleaning and Testing (DES007).

(4) The motor stopped turning. Check the Packing Nut to make sure it is not over-tightened. Refer to DELTA Service Procedure Agitator Packing Maintenance and Nut Adjustment (DES001).

(5) The motor needs to be replaced. Refer to DELTA Service Procedure Motor Assembly Replacement (DES023).
